Today, dear readers, I will tell you about an interesting mechanical mod (Greece). We have already got acquainted with the products of this modder (D-Base Tank, THE Dripper Pro, ΣΟΦΙΑ/Sophia). The participant of today’s review is called bOd MECHA.
bOd MECHA is a telescope mechanical mod that allows you to use 18350, 18490/18500, 18650 batteries. The device has a function for adjusting the airflow intensity for evaporators that capture air at the bottom of the connector (AFC – Adjustable Air Flow Control).

But the main feature of bOd MECHA is its switch. Unlike most devices on the market, this product does not have a separate “button”, here this function is implemented in the “head”. That is, the upper part of the device (“head”) combines the functions of a connector, switch, AFC, and liquid chamber.

The operation of the bOd MECHA switch (button)
To understand the principle of operation of the switch of the device in question, look at the following photos. On the first one, the “button” is not pressed (voltage is not supplied), on the second one, it is pressed:

We will study this unit in more detail later. Now I will note that when the button is pressed, the evaporator connector is lowered and its “plus” comes into contact with the positive contact of the battery block. This can be seen in the following photos.

Incredibly simple! Straight to the point of elegance.

The logic of voltage supply in the device is as follows:
the negative contact of the battery contacts the spring of the battery compartment cover (or directly with the cover, this is also possible). The minus is transmitted through the cover and the telescope pipes to the “head” of the device. Then from the battery block connector it is fed to the evaporator connector;
the positive contact of the battery contacts the positive contact of the “head”. Until the evaporator connector is “pulled” to this contact, the circuit is open. When they touch, power begins to be supplied to the evaporator coil;
in the case of using voltage regulation devices (Kick, Crown and the like), these devices are constantly under load. Since the power supply circuit is broken only in the “head” of the battery block. This does not affect anything, except for one thing – such devices can make quiet, almost imperceptible sounds (for example, the second version of Kick quietly “crackles”). When using batteries without additional electronics, this does not manifest itself in any way.

Specifications of bOd MECHA by Leo
outer diameter of wide parts 23 mm, narrow part (telescope) 20 mm, locking ring 24.5 mm;
inner diameters: inner telescopic part 18.9 mm, outer (along threads) 20.3 mm;
length with 18350 battery 69 mm;
with 18490 battery 79 mm;
with 18650 battery 95 mm;
weight 105 g;
battery compartment cover spring resistance 13 mOhm (measured brass spring installed in the device provided for review).
The length of the 18490 and 18650 assembly was measured with AW IMR batteries.
